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Split ticketing means that instead of purchasing one rail ticket for your journey we automatically find and help you book two or more tickets instead, covering exactly the same journey. We call it our FairSplit.

Station Facilities and Ticketing

Newport (Essex) station is equipped with facilities to cater to both regular commuters and occasional travelers. The ticket office is open from 06:00 to 09:10 on weekdays, with convenient ticket machines available for purchasing and collecting tickets at any time. The station has enabled smart card services as well, including issuance and verification, to expedite your commuting process.

For those in need of assistance, customer information is readily available at the ticket office during operating hours. The station offers step-free access to platforms, although wheelchair access across platforms involves a footbridge. While facilities like an induction loop and accessible ticket machines support inclusivity, there are currently no accessible taxis or specialized mobility set down points provided.

Travel Connections and Amenities

Beyond rail services, Newport (Essex) station has enabled connections with other transport modes. There is a designated rail replacement service stop, though accessibility considerations are noted. Taxis can be booked by calling 01799 661266, and you can find more details at www.audleyendtaxis.com. Local bus services also offer convenient options for your onward journey.

While the station doesn’t host refreshment services, shops, or currency exchanges, it offers other traveler-friendly features such as public WiFi, which you can find more about through this WiFi locator.

Station Facilities and Services

Enfield Lock Station offers a straightforward and user-friendly experience. For ticketing, the station has a ticket office that opens from early morning to shortly after midday on weekdays and Saturdays. However, if you’re planning a Sunday visit, do note the ticket office will be closed. No worries though, ticket machines are available, making it easy to buy tickets and collect those purchased online. Accessible ticket machines and smartcard services, including validators, ensure convenience for tech-savvy travelers.

While you’re at the station, you’ll notice the accessibility efforts made for travelers. Step-free access is available in parts of the station, and ramps are provided for train access. There’s also an induction loop for those with hearing impairments. You'll find a coffee kiosk if you need a quick refreshment, but other amenities there are fairly basic, with no waiting rooms or extensive shops available.

Onward Travel from Enfield Lock

Traveling beyond Enfield Lock is incredibly convenient, thanks to a plethora of options. London buses run routes directly from outside the station, offering a seamless transition from rail to road. For those driving, it’s wise to consider car hire options as parking is not directly available at the station. If you're planning on traveling by cycle, bicycle stands offer a secure parking solution, conveniently located on the approach to Platform 1. While rail replacement services don’t operate here, alternative diversionary routes ensure continued travel with ease.
